No Battery In Smoke Detector In Motel Room Where 2 Children Were Killed In Fire
CO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. (CBS4) - Investigators now say there was a smoke detector in the room of a motel in Colorado Springs where a fire killed two children, but somebody took the battery out.
Five people were trapped inside the room at the Ranch Motel when the fire started Saturday morning.

Two-year-old Cheyenne Jones and her 4-year-old brother Wade died. Their mother, another child, and a man survived.
Investigators have not said yet if the fire was intentionally set or an accident.
